/***
|
||||
*** Module for parsing resolv.conf files.
|
||||
***
|
||||
*** entry points are:
|
||||
*** lwres_conf_init(lwres_conf_t *confdata)
|
||||
*** intializes data structure for subsequent parsing.
|
||||
***
|
||||
*** lwres_conf_parse(lwres_context_t *ctx, const char *filename,
|
||||
*** lwres_conf_t *confdata)
|
||||
*** parses a file and fills in the data structure.
|
||||
***
|
||||
*** lwres_conf_print(FILE *fp, lwres_conf_t *confdata)
|
||||
*** prints the data structure to the FILE.
|
||||
***
|
||||
*** lwres_conf_clear(lwres_context_t *ctx, lwres_conf_t *confdata)
|
||||
*** frees up all the internal memory used by the data
|
||||
*** structure.
|
||||
***
|
||||
***/
